Academy record a comfortable home win v Huntly – 14th
Feb 2015

Wick Academy 4 – Huntly 0 – Two
goals in the opening two minutes had Wick Academy on easy street at home to
Huntly. Davie Allan opened the scoring in the first minute before Lukasz
Geruzel added a second a minute later. Geruzel added a third after 21 minutes
before Steven Anderson completed the scoring in the 74th minute.

Brora Rangers 4 – Strathspey Thistle 0
Martin Maclean headed the opener for Brora at home to Strathspey in the 44th
minute before Zander Sutherland added a second just before half-time.
Sutherland got his second before Steven Mackay completed the scoring late on
with a penalty.

Buckie Thistle 2 – Fraserburgh 2
Kevin Fraser gave Buckie the lead at home to Fraserburgh in the 51st minute
with a header from a corner. Two quick fire goals from Scott Barbour and P A
Bruce had Fraserburgh in front but Buckie equalised in stoppage time when
keeper Andy Burr netted a header from a corner.

Clachnacuddin 5 – Lossiemouth 1
Scott Miller gave Lossiemouth the lead away to Clach in the 67th minute before
Gordon Morrison equalised from the spot in the 76th minute. Four goals in a
nine minute spell late in the game won it for Clach. David McGurk, Scott
Davidson, Blair Lawrie and Ian Penwright all got on the score sheet.

Formartine United 3 – Cove Rangers 0
Formartine took the lead at home to Cove in the 25th minute when Graham Hay
powered home a corner. Callum Bagshaw added a second just before half-time
before Marek Madle completed the scoring in the 88th minute rounding off a
counter attack.

Forres Mechanics 6 – Rothes 2 – Lee
Fraser gave Forres the lead at home to Rothes in the 15th minute before Steven
Fraser made it 2-0 minutes later. Two goals in two minutes from Paul Smith and
Scott Moore seemed to have put Forres in command but Rothes pulled a goal back
immediately through Stuart Hodge. Gary Lamberton pulled another back for Rothes
before Craig McGovern and Andrew Smith added further goals for Forres.

Inverurie Locos 2 – Deveronvale 4
Graeme Roger gave Deveronvale a second minute lead away to Inverurie before
Sean Keith added a second in the 18th minute. Martin Bavidge pulled a goal back
in the 32nd minute but Stuart Leslie put Deveronvale 3-1 up. Colin Charlesworth
added a fourth before Ryan Keir pulled one back.

Keith 2 – Turriff United 7
Gary McGowan gave Turriff a 13th minute lead from the spot away to Keith. Craig
Cormack equalised ten minutes later but McGowan put Turriff back in front in
the 26th minute. Grant Mitchell equalised for Keith but Andy MacAskill put
Turriff in front just before half-time. Lewis Davidson added a fourth in the
66th minute before three goals in the last ten minutes from Craig MacAskill and
a double from his brother Andrew completed the scoring.

Nairn County 4 – Fort
William 0
– Adam Naismith gave Nairn a first half lead
at home to Fort William before Conor Gethins added a second from the penalty
spot. Naismith added a third before John Cameron completed the scoring.
